Movie Info

Synopsis A teen (Jordan-Claire Green) believes her summer is ruined after her parents pack her off to visit the grandfather (Paul Dooley) she barely knows.
Director
Doug McKeon
Producer
Gregg Russell, Robert D. Slane, Stephen Zakman
Screenwriter
Robert D. Slane
Production Co
Stephen M. Zakman Productions, High Tide Entertainment, Haven Films Inc.
Rating
PG (Brief Language|Mild Thematic Elements)
Genre
Drama
Original Language
English
Release Date (Theaters)
Apr 29, 2005, Original
Release Date (DVD)
Apr 8, 2014
Box Office (Gross USA)
$71.6K
Runtime
1h 42m
